Last clean, next clean, per drop.
The point is not the picture. It is that every drop carries its own history.
- Last clean. A client asking about third floor north gets a date, not a search through job sheets.
- Next scheduled. Forward schedule per drop. An elevation that has slipped shows as a gap on the model.
- Assigned, or explicitly not. Where a drop cannot be assigned, the model says so and why. Contingency gets planned instead of discovered.
- Capture at the drop. Completion and photographs attach to the drop that was worked. Evidence and location cannot drift apart.

What is a drop in facade cleaning?
A drop is one vertical section of one elevation, worked as a single descent by a rope access or cradle team. Elevations are split into numbered drops so that scheduling, completion and photographic evidence attach to a specific section of the building rather than to the building as a whole.
